Output 5ba2874cfdf617f23e5a94f48cc982660fde0866c33978977a48ec3fb694547b:1

value
211396017
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ae4edda92bd2884e5bfad4407b14c98eb6efd315 OP_EQUAL
address
3HafycphpTsqYJo7MCF7m6R3yGfKQfQty1
transaction
5ba2874cfdf617f23e5a94f48cc982660fde0866c33978977a48ec3fb694547b
confirmations
342375
spent
true